Minella Trump Grand National Wins

Minella Trump has never won the Grand National.

Their best finish to date was in 2023 where they came 15th. They were ridden by Theo Gillard and trained by Donald McCain Jnr.

Trained by Donald McCain, it is fair to say that before his attempt at the 2023 Grand National, Minella Trump didn’t really look like the ideal contender for the race. Before that Aintree outing, he’d run just three times at three miles, never more than that, and although he’d won all those three races over the distance of three miles, they were all low-grade contests, summer races.

Foaled in 2014, despite the fact he never really looked like a Grand National type, he did have two major positives in his favour before the race. The first his trainer, Donald McCain, a winner of the Grand National and son of Ginger McCain, the trainer of Red Rum, a Grand National legend. Secondly, over fences, he’d improved massively, winning six in a row and eight out of nine in his starts before the 2023 Grand National. He started that run with a rating of 125 and ran in the 2023 Grand National off a mark of 147.

Minella Trump’s Early Years

Minella Trump grand national runner 2023 head close upIn March of 2019, Minella Trump would hit a racetrack for the first time in a point-to-point race in Ireland, his only run in amateur races, and also a very impressive win to get things started. He won his maiden point-to-point race by six lengths, and after that, he was transferred over the Irish Sea and to the Donald McCain yard, where he would begin a career under rules.

He went straight over hurdles for McCain and hit the ground running, winning his first two starts, both novice hurdle races. He then went handicapping, with a couple of second-placed efforts and a fourth to round off his season.

The following year he went chasing but struggled, and after three big defeats over fences, he went back hurdling, running three times and finishing in the first three in them all, winning his last effort.

Then came a big run of wins for Minella Trump, as the horse finally got the hang of things over the bigger obstacles. Between August 2012 and November 2021, he won six races in a row, five handicaps and one novice chase, three at Perth first, followed up by wins at Sedgefield, Sandown and Catterick. He improved 15lb and was brilliantly placed by trainer Donald McCain, allowing the horse to pick up plenty of prize money but keeping him to low-grade races and not seeing his handicap mark raised too much during that time.

Minella Trump’s Big Race Wins

Despite being a prolific winner during his career, Minella Trump was not able to win a big race during his rise through the ranks. This wasn’t because he failed but simply because he didn’t get the chance to perform at that level.

A class two handicap chase win at Perth in June 2022 is his highest-class victory so far, but also the highest race he ran in prior to running in the 2023 Grand National. Rather than going for the big pots, trainer Donald McCain decided it was better to go for a number of smaller pots, keep the horse busy, and mop up those races, which is precisely what he did.
